Re: Hard-to-find products in Canada
      03/28/07 11:33 AM
craftymeg

Reged: 07/07/06
Posts: 64
Loc: Newfoundland, Canada

I found baked tostitos scoops at Wal-Mart and Amy's soups and dinners at Dominion supermarkets (Atlantic Canada, other names in other provinces for the same company I believe).
